Conductivity meter • Analog 4…20 mA output • Universal process connection • Three cell constants for covering a wide measuring range • Temperature compensated measurement Type 8222 neutrino can be combined with… Type 8611 eCONTROL Universal controller Type 8619 multiCELL Transmitter/Controller The Bürkert neutrino meter Type 8222 is a compact device designed for measuring the conductivity of fluids. The conductivity meter consists of a sensor plugged-in and pined to an enclosure with cover, containing the electronic module. The sensor holder comprises a cell with two electrodes and a Pt1000 temperature sensor. The sensor itself is available with three different cell constants C, these with C = 0.01 or 0.1 are fitted with stainless steel electrodes and this with C = 1.0 is fitted with graphite electrodes. The neutrino conductivity meter Type 8222 is available with one 2-wire 4…20 mA current output and with two different connections: either a G 1½ union nut for adaptor with G 1½ external threaded sensor connection or a G ¾ threaded holder for screwing into an adaptor with G ¾ internal thread sensor connection. 8222 ELEMENT neutrino Principle of operation Conductivity is defined as the ability of a solution to conduct electrical current. The load carriers are ions (E.G. dissolved salt or acids). In order to measure conductivity 2 electrodes are used which are set at a fixed distance apart and with a known specified surface. An AC voltage source is connected to the electrodes. The measured current is a direct function of the conductivity of the solution. The conductivity meter is a two-wire device, which requires a power supply of 12…36 V DC.
